Sweet and Savory Grape Jelly Meatballs Recipe
- Total Time: 4–6 hours (low) or 2–3 hours (high)
- Yield: 8 1x
Description
Succulent grape jelly meatballs blend sweet and tangy flavors in a delightful culinary journey through comfort food. Perfectly seasoned beef, glazed with a luscious sauce, promises to enchant dinner guests and satisfy comfort cravings you’ll adore.
Ingredients
Main Ingredients:
- 2 pounds frozen meatballs
- 1 cup grape jelly
- 1 cup barbecue sauce
Seasoning and Flavor Enhancers:
- 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
Instructions
- Create a luscious glaze by blending grape jelly, tangy barbecue sauce, Worcestershire sauce, and garlic powder in a saucepan over medium heat, whisking until silky smooth and gently warmed.
- Transfer frozen meatballs to a slow cooker, cascading the prepared sauce over them to ensure complete and uniform coating.
- Set slow cooker to low temperature for 4-6 hours or high temperature for 2-3 hours, periodically stirring to promote even sauce distribution and consistent heating.
- When meatballs are thoroughly heated and sauce has thickened, gently transfer to a serving platter.
- Garnish with optional chopped parsley or green onions for added visual appeal and fresh flavor accent.
- Present as a delectable appetizer during gatherings or serve atop fluffy rice for a satisfying main course, allowing guests to savor the sweet and savory combination.
Notes
- Choose high-quality grape jelly for a richer, more balanced flavor profile that complements the savory meatballs perfectly.
- Opt for homemade or pre-made meatballs depending on time constraints, ensuring they are uniform in size for consistent cooking.
- Experiment with different barbecue sauce varieties like smoky, spicy, or honey-based to customize the dish’s taste and complexity.
- For a gluten-free version, use gluten-free barbecue sauce and meatballs, and serve over cauliflower rice or quinoa instead of traditional rice.
